A town is a type of populated place in the Canadian Province of Nova Scotia. Towns are incorporated by order by the Nova Scotia Utility and Review Board according to sections 383 through 388 of Nova Scotia's Municipal Government Act.[1]

Thumb
Distribution of Nova Scotia's 27 towns by population

Nova Scotia had 25 towns at the time of the 2021 Census. In 2021, the towns had a cumulative population of 96,580. Nova Scotia's largest and smallest towns are Truro and Lockeport with populations of 12,954 and 476 respectively.
